Did the Beatles record I Want to Hold Your Hand in German?

Fifty years ago today, The Beatles recorded “Komm, Gib Mir Deine Hand,” a version of “I Want to Hold Your Hand” translated into German. The German division of EMI had convinced their manager that the record wouldn’t be successful in Germany if the English version was released there.

Which Beatles song took longest to record?

Initial sessions for “Helter Skelter” were so intense that they ultimately included the longest song the Beatles ever recorded: a 27-minute version of the track that later appeared on their self-titled double album in abbreviated form.

Why did the Beatles do German songs?

The record label pressured the Beatles into releasing German versions of “I want to hold your hand” and “She Loves you”, because they were convinced that the German market wouldn’t buy English language songs. It was a common practice at the time.

What are the shortest Beatles songs?

At 23 seconds long, “Her Majesty” is the shortest song in the Beatles’ repertoire (contrasting the same album’s “I Want You (She’s So Heavy)”, their longest song apart from “Revolution 9”, an 8:22 avant-garde piece from The Beatles).

Why did the Beatles write a day in the life?

A core inspiration for the song – specifically John Lennon’s opening sequence, about a man who “blew his mind out in a car” – pertained to the death of Tara Browne, who had died in a car accident on December 18th, 1966. The 21-year-old Browne was the heir to the Guinness fortune and a friend of the Beatles’.
